Aly Raisman is a retired American gymnast. She was the captain of the U.S. women's gymnastics team at the 2012 and 2016 Olympics and won six Olympic medals in all, including three gold medals.

With six Olympic medals, which include three gold, two silver, and one bronze, from the 2012 to 2016 Games, Aly Raisman stands tall as the third-most decorated American gymnast in Olympic history.
